New World: Aeternum’s third wave of server merges will officially launch on April 29. Since its release in 2024, this MMORPG has already experienced server merges in November 2024 and February 2025.
After the third round, the game is expected to retain 28 servers, marking another key step for the developer in maintaining game balance.
According to official news, the scale of this merger is not large, and it will mainly affect the two major service areas of Draco and Rosa. The specific adjustment plan is: Draco players in European area will be migrated to Aries as a whole, and Rosa will be merged into Hudsonlandon on the US Eastside.
It is worth noting that after this server merger, New World: Aeternum Coins held by players will be universal across servers, so players populating Draco and Rosa can temporarily not worry too much about the problem of their assets not being protected.
